Moorpark, CA

Ventura County

Heavy Restrictions

California Government Code §12955 makes it unlawful for Moorpark landlords to refuse rental to applicants because they pay with Section 8 vouchers or other lawful housing-assistance payments — source-of-income discrimination is a Fair Employment and Housing Act violation.

Moorpark FAQ

Can a Moorpark landlord refuse Section 8?

No. Source-of-income discrimination is illegal statewide under Government Code §12955; vouchers must be accepted and screened on the same terms as other applicants.

Who runs Section 8 in Moorpark?

Ventura County Area Housing Authority (AHA) administers Housing Choice Vouchers for Moorpark and most of Ventura County's incorporated cities.
